Job Description

DESCRIPTION:

The Technical/Production Manager is the primary in-site GMO management representative assigned to the various CBS News productions. Works closely with the Producers, Directors, personnel scheduling, and others to ensure that each production has what is needed. Oversees and coordinates the delivery of all CBS resources to production, including technical and stage labor, distribution, support personnel (make-up, hair, wardrobe), production facilities, building facilities, security, Aramark, etc. Works with scheduling to ensure that client billing is correct, timely, and clearly presented to the client.

Another critical aspect of this position, especially during live production, is to check-in and coordinate all live remotes, including satellite, fiber, zoom, Skype, etc. to ensure that remote guests and talent can hear the control room; that the control can see and hear the remote; that the audio, video, Director and AD know how to see, hear and speak to the remote talent; and to troubleshoot any issues with regard to the remote.

Responsibilities:
• Manages and oversees the daily studio operations of various productions.
• Manages the below-the-line personnel assigned to the production.
• Works directly with the client (Directors, Producers, Managers, etc.) and other GMO and CBS departments to facilitate below-the-line production planning and execution.
• Technical/Production Manager is responsible for all below-the-line production costs and billing and works closely with both GMO and CBS News Operations Finance and Accounting to assure accurate and timely billing as well as financial reporting for each production.
• Responsible for maintaining a high level of customer satisfaction. Works closely with Scheduling on the final actualization and billing of work orders in MediaPulse.

QUALIFICATIONS:
• Minimum of 5 years of television production/operations experience.
• Must have an in-depth understanding of studio and post-production in a live environment.
• Must have an understanding of the technical capabilities of the facility and how it can be used most effectively and efficiently to the benefit of the production.
• Must be able to handle numerous issues and details in real-time during the production process, beginning with an initial production meeting, all the way through delivery of the completed program.
• Must be a self-starter who is comfortable working in a fast-paced, high-pressure environment.
• Must be willing to work a varied schedule including early mornings, late nights, weekends, holidays, and long days as needed.
• Must become familiar with the details of our several collective bargaining agreements. Must be computer literate, with a particular emphasis on Microsoft Excel.
• Must become familiar with Xytech MediaPulse.
